SeaCube Container Leasing Ltd. Reports Second Quarter 2011 Results

Second Quarter 2011 and Year-to-Date Highlights

  • For the second quarter, adjusted net income was $10.4 million, a year-over-year increase of 30%. Adjusted net income per diluted common share was $0.51. Net income was $9.4 million.
  • Declared a dividend of $0.24 per share, representing a 9% increase from the previous quarter’s dividend.
  • Total revenue was $40.8 million for the second quarter, a year-over-year increase of 21%.
  • Average utilization was 98.6% for the second quarter.
  • Ordered approximately $400 million in new equipment for delivery through November 2011; 90% is committed to long-term leases.

PARK RIDGE, N.J.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--August 9, 2011--SeaCube Container Leasing Ltd (SeaCube) (NYSE: BOX), one of the world’s largest lessors of intermodal freight containers, today reported results for the second quarter ended June 30, 2011.

Adjusted net income(1) was $10.4 million for the second quarter of 2011 compared to $8.0 million in the second quarter of 2010, an increase of 30%. For the second quarter of 2011, adjusted net income per diluted common share was $0.51. The Company focuses on adjusted net income because it excludes the impact of non-cash interest expense and non-recurring items that are unrelated to the operating performance of the business.

Total revenue was $40.8 million for the second quarter of 2011 compared to $33.6 million for the second quarter of 2010, an increase of 21%. Utilization continues to be strong with average second quarter utilization of 98.6%. Adjusted EBITDA(1) was $60.8 million for the second quarter of 2011, compared to $53.0 million in the second quarter of 2010.

The Company reported net income of $9.4 million for the second quarter of 2011 compared to $7.3 million for the second quarter of 2010. Net income per diluted common share was $0.47 for the second quarter of 2011, compared to $0.45 for the second quarter of 2010.

Joseph Kwok, Chief Executive Officer of SeaCube, commented, “SeaCube generated strong revenue and earnings growth in the second quarter, as we continued to benefit from our investments in new containers. In 2011 year-to-date, we have ordered approximately $400 million of new equipment, surpassing the amount we invested in 2010 and our original plan for 2011. Consistent with our strategy of maintaining strong utilization, 90% of the new containers are already committed to long-term leases.”

Mr. Kwok continued, “As we progress through the second half of the year, SeaCube remains well positioned to continue to achieve strong year-over-year revenue and earnings growth. Our year-to-date investment of $400 million is expected to be completed by November, and we will continue to make investments that are in the best interests of our shareholders. Our primary focus will be on the refrigerated container market, enabling the Company to take advantage of favorable sector fundamentals and further solidify its position as the largest lessor of refrigerated containers.”


Mr. Kwok concluded, “Based on our strong results for the second quarter, our Board of Directors declared a dividend of $0.24 per share, which is an increase of 9%. Since going public in November 2010, this is the second time SeaCube has raised its dividend and we have declared cumulative dividends of $0.88 per share.”

Adjusted net income(1) was $19.6 million for the six months ended June 30, 2011, compared to $16.8 million for the six months ended June 30, 2010. For the six months ended June 30, 2011, adjusted net income per diluted common share was $0.98.

Total revenue was $77.6 million for the six months ended June 30, 2011 compared to $66.8 million for the six months ended June 30, 2010. Adjusted EBITDA(1) was $113.6 million for the six months ended June 30, 2011 compared to $105.1 million for the six months ended June 30, 2010.

The Company reported net income of $18.4 million for the six months ended June 30, 2011 compared to $14.5 million for the six months ended June 30, 2010. Net income per diluted common share was $0.91 for the six months ended June 30, 2011 compared to $0.90 for the six months ended June 30, 2010.

About SeaCube Container Leasing Ltd.

SeaCube Container Leasing Ltd. is one of the world’s largest container leasing companies based on total assets. Containers are the primary means by which products are shipped internationally because they facilitate the secure and efficient movement of goods via multiple transportation modes, including ships, rail and trucks. The principal activities of our business include the acquisition, leasing, re-leasing and subsequent sale of refrigerated and dry containers and generator sets. We lease our containers primarily under long-term contracts to a diverse group of the world’s leading shipping lines. As of June 30, 2011, we employed 76 people in seven offices worldwide and had total assets of $1.4 billion. We own or manage a fleet of 558,294 units, representing 878,397 twenty-foot equivalent units (TEUs) of containers and generator sets.

Non-GAAP Financial Measure

The Company has presented adjusted earnings before interest, taxes, depreciation and amortization (adjusted EBITDA) as a measure of operating results. We define adjusted EBITDA as income (loss) from continuing operations before income taxes, interest expenses including loss on retirement of debt, depreciation and amortization, fair value adjustments on derivative instruments, loss on terminations and modification of derivative instruments, gain on sale of assets, and write-offs of goodwill plus principal collections on direct finance lease receivables. SeaCube has presented adjusted EBITDA as a supplemental financial measure as a means to evaluate performance of the Company’s business. SeaCube believes that, when viewed with GAAP results and the accompanying reconciliation, it provides a more complete understanding of factors and trends affecting the Company’s business than the GAAP results alone. Adjusted EBITDA is a non-GAAP measure, and, as such, a reconciliation of adjusted EBITDA to net income is provided below.

In addition, the Company has presented adjusted net income, adjusted net income per diluted common share and pro forma adjusted net income per diluted common share as a measure of financial and operating performance. We define adjusted net income (loss) as net income before non-cash interest expense related to terminations and modifications of derivative instruments, losses on retirement of debt, fair value adjustments on derivative instruments, loss on swap terminations, write-offs of goodwill and gain on the sale of assets. We use adjusted net income to assess our consolidated financial and operating performance, and we believe this non-GAAP measure is helpful to management and investors in identifying trends in our performance. Adjusted net income is a non-GAAP measure, and, as such, a reconciliation of adjusted net income to net income is provided below.
